The HYZ Champagne Stopper with Vacuum 3Pack features an exclusive built-in pump piston system that efficiently increases bottle pressure to preserve carbonation and freshness for up to a week. Crafted from premium stainless steel and ABS, these airtight, leak-proof stoppers fit all standard sparkling wine bottles including champagne, Prosecco, and Cava. Dishwasher safe and available in a stylish trio of gold, rose gold, and black, they’re the ultimate accessory for bubbly lovers who refuse to waste a single drop.

Amazing – if I could give it six stars I would. I don’t say that very often. My wife loves bubbly but we don’t drink much of it because the second day it’s flat and tasteless. Years ago we had a pumper that worked, sort of, but over time it wore out. With Christmas coming I went to Total Wine and asked what they had, to preserve bubbly - they said nothing. This shocked me. So I really dug in and looked at everything on Amazon, this one rose to the top. And it works incredibly well (so far) – I’ve used it with four bottles in the first month. You press it down securely then fit the “wings” over the bottle until they CLICK - it's very audible, you know when it clicks. Then you pump it up – which is really easy, doesn't take alot of strength. When the bottle is ¾ full I pump about 30-40 times, half full 50-60 times, and so on. A day or two later (keep it in the fridge) you pull the wings off carefully so it doesn’t accidentally pop up into your face (a problem with any champagne bottle) and then lift gently. It doesn’t just make a nice pop, it makes a gentle explosion, like opening a bottle for the first time! It holds serious pressure for days (as much as you want to pump) and the bubbles are perfectly preserved. I read many reviews before purchasing and one said that there are some bottle tneck ypes that don’t fit snugly, so he wraps a rubber band around the neck and it helps hold the seal. Haven’t had that issue so far because all of my bottles are pretty standard. A couple of times after putting it into the fridge early on it would pop, apparently I wasn't clicking it snugly. So I now wrap a rubber band around the wingsj just in case to hold them in, no problems so far. But if you are able to get the wings to click firmly it shouldn’t be a problem. It’s pretty well built but it is made with some plastic and some reviews said it can break. That’s OK, I’m just being careful. Nice that you get two units for the price. If after a year I have to replace one or both of them, it’s worth it in savings and in drinking more of what my wife loves. Give it a try.

I have used several sparkling wine preservers, including expensive ones with gas canisters, and these work as well. There may be a slight difference, but it's not perceptible. I wouldn't use this on your Cristal. I wouldn't leave it for a week. However, if you have a nice bottle of Cava, and you don't want to drink it all, this stopper works a treat. BTW it is NOT a vacuum pump. Why would you want that? It pumps room air into the void to maintain the sparkle. Significantly, for me, is the fact that there are no consumables - and those gas canisters are not cheap!

I never leave reviews, so this is special. We used this closure on a bottle of champagne. We kept it closed for about 2 weeks. We were shocked, when we opened it up, it was just like we had never opened it. It was fantastic. The key to it working so well is that it puts pressure into the bottle, which stops it from losing its' fizz. We absolutely love it! Note - this would not work for wine, because for wine, you want to remove the air, but for champagne, you want to add pressure.
